Hi,
I just noticed a problem. One of my membership plans is $1 trial for the first 3 days, than $9 per month. The s2 buy code works, PayPal has it set up as expected:

Subscription Terms:	$1.00 USD for the first 3 days
Then $9.00 USD for each month

I had a user sign up for this yesterday, on Aug 1st, and cancelled 6 minutes later, but his automatic EOT was set by s2 as Aug 31, 2013.

What could have caused this? I do not have s2 logging turned on, so I have no logs on this.
